TURN-208: Gatevale turnstile counters at the Merrow Field pilot double-count when a rotation reverses mid-cycle. Attendance totals drift roughly 2% high per event. The debounce window fix is implemented, reviewed by Ilsa, and soak-tested across two simulated match days without drift. Ready for your cut; the candidate build is identified below.

trace token, tagag-tafog: htk6_5ed18c

Release manager: the Quillhaven report builder depends on a stable sort when grouping rows by account tier. The underlying comparator ties frequently, and an unstable sort would reorder line items between runs, producing spurious diffs in the nightly comparison job. Do not swap the sort implementation during a release without re-baselining those diffs. The constants below control tie-breaking and batch sizes; treat them as frozen. Current values follow.

constants for fajop-tahaf:
RATE_LIMITS = {
    "holael": 2,
    "oliael": 10,
    "druael": 10,
    "wenwyn": 10,
}

Migration Step 3: CSV Import Wizard — Granary Suite

For this week's sync: the wizard now validates column mappings server-side instead of in the browser. Old client-side mapping presets are ignored after the upgrade, so teams should re-save any shared templates. Delimiter detection is automatic but can be overridden per tenant. The batch size and validation thresholds moved out of code into deploy-time settings, which currently read as follows.

service settings:
novath:
  pin: 1396
  tenant: pelys
  seal: seal_ccc035e1
  metrics_host: metrics.novath.qorvelworks.test
  standby_team: fraeth
  escalation: drueth-zorok
  nonce: 61d508

## Changelog — Hashgate v1.9

Quick one for on-call: `BLOOM_BITS` is now `HASHGATE_FILTER_BITS`. Same knob, better name — it sizes the bloom filter sitting in front of the KV store, not the store itself. If false-positive rates spike after a deploy, odds are someone's env file still has the old key. Fix the name, then make sure the filter sync secret sits right below it:

vault entry, yahif-yajep: COURIER_KEY29=b802bdf8034096b65a51c6ba5abe2